Engineer
Lensa is a career site that helps job seekers find great jobs in the US. We are not a staffing firm or agency. Lensa does not hire directly for these jobs, but promotes jobs on LinkedIn on behalf of its direct clients, recruitment ad agencies, and marketing partners. Lensa partners with DirectEmployers to promote this job for Amazon. Clicking "Apply Now" or "Read more" on Lensa redirects you to the job board/employer site. Any information collected there is subject to their terms and privacy notice.
Description If you are interested in this position, please apply on Twitch's Career site About Us Twitch is the world’s biggest live streaming service, with global communities built around gaming, entertainment, music, sports, cooking, and more. It is where thousands of communities come together for whatever, every day. We’re about community, inside and out. You’ll find coworkers who are eager to team up, collaborate, and smash (or elegantly solve) problems together. We’re on a quest to empower live communities, so if this sounds good to you, see what we’re up to on LinkedIn and X, and discover the projects we’re solving on our Blog. Be sure to explore our Interviewing Guide to learn how to ace our interview process. About The Role Are you a TypeScript enthusiast? Is React your jam? If so, you’ll be right at home on the Browser Clients Team. We build and maintain the client-side framework that powers As a Front-end Engineer, you’ll be integral to shipping performant, high quality, and delightful software to Twitch viewers and creators. You can work in San Francisco, CA or Irvine, CA. You Will- Work effectively with the Browser Clients team and feature teams to build high quality Twitch client experiences.
- Build, maintain and improve the platform capabilities, developer workflows, tools, and processes that enable feature teams to ship their changes with confidence and velocity.
- Become an expert in Twitch’s browser-client technology stack and provide guidance to feature teams on implementing their front-end use cases and understanding their performance in production.
- Contribute to architectural, technical design, and process discussions which guide the evolution of Twitch’s browser-based clients.
- Identify and uphold frontend engineering best practices through documentation, static analysis, testing and developer education efforts.
- Medical, Dental, Vision & Disability Insurance
- 401(k)
- Maternity & Parental Leave
- Flexible PTO
- Amazon Employee Discount
- A degree in Computer Science, a related Engineering discipline, or equivalent experience
- 2+ years experience working on large scale JavaScript applications
- Experience with TypeScript
- Experience with React
- A good understanding of CSS
- Strong analytical problem solving skills
- Architectural experience creating highly-scalable web applications
- A solid understanding of best practices and techniques regarding web scalability, performance, and security
- Experience with GraphQL, especially the Apollo Client
- Experience with SCSS or SASS
- Experience with Webpack
- Experience with React Testing Library, Playwright, or other major testing frameworks
Recommended Jobs
CNA Certified Nursing Assistant- Confirm Schedules in app!
Location: Goshen, NY 10924 Date Posted: 09/30/2025 Category: Nursing Education: None CNA - confirm shifts in our app! Competitive compensation- up to $25/hr CNAs are needed by o…
Group Product Manager, Member Experience
About Atria Atria is a membership-based preventive health care practice delivering cutting-edge primary and specialty care from the comfort of your home, at our practices in Palm Beach and New York,…
Treasury Sales Officer, Non-Bank Financial Institution Segment
At Bank of America, we are guided by a common purpose to help make financial lives better through the power of every connection. We do this by driving Responsible Growth and delivering for our …
Product Manager, Clinical Programs
The Gist Vim is the fastest growing middleware platform transforming healthcare. Experience the power of seamless data exchange and collaboration among providers, payers, tech companies, and more.…
Quality Compliance Manager (Saranac Lake, NY)
This position is responsible for ensuring a state of continuous GMP compliance of Client’s services and activities. This requires a combination of regulatory knowledge, attention to detail, effective …
Delivery Driver
Duties and Responsibilities # Able to fulfill job descriptions of cut & pack and cook. # Delivers finished menu items to guest’s home or office. # Accepts payment for food upon delivery. # Kee…
Full Time Geriatrics Job Brooklyn, NY
A leading healthcare organization is seeking a dedicated, licensed Physician to join their Primary Care team in Brooklyn. About the Opportunity: Schedule: Monday to Friday Hours: 9am to 5p…
Marketing vice president and house
Are you ready to take iconic brands to the next level? We’re looking for a strategic marketing leader to own the US marketing strategy for brands like The Balvenie and Monkey Shoulder, which are at t…
Licensed Social Worker for League School
If you are an experienced professional who enjoys being part of a multidisciplinary team and is seeking to enhance life for the betterment of children in our program, we would like to hear from you. …
Customer Support Liaison
Description Under the direct supervision of the Communications Coordinator, the Customer Service Representative (CSR) will be an initial phone/in-person contact for active clients, families and comm…